加速你的网站:WordPress优化终极指南

2 分钟阅读
2026-03-18
2026-06-04
2,165
通过下方链接进行购物时,您无需支付额外费用,我就能获得佣金。.

一個載入緩慢的網站會直接導致使用者流失、轉化率下降,並在搜尋引擎排名中處於不利地位。WordPress 作為全球最流行的內容管理系統,其強大的靈活性和豐富的外掛生態也可能帶來效能負擔。幸運的是,透過一系列系統性的最佳化措施,你可以顯著提升網站速度,改善使用者體驗和 SEO 表現。本指南將為你提供從基礎到進階的完整最佳化方案。

WordPress效能瓶頸分析

在開始最佳化之前,瞭解常見的效能瓶頸至關重要。這能幫助你精準定位問題,避免盲目操作。

伺服器與託管環境的影響

你的託管服務是網站效能的基石。共享主機雖然便宜,但資源(如CPU、記憶體)是與其他使用者共享的,容易因鄰居站點流量激增而受到影響。虛擬專用伺服器(VPS)或專用伺服器提供了更獨立的資源,而云主機和最佳化的 WordPress 託管(如 Kinsta, WP Engine)通常集成了快取、CDN 和效能調優,是追求速度的理想選擇。

推荐阅读 一步到位的WordPress优化指南:从提升速度到增强安全性,全面提升网站性能的策略

主題與外掛帶來的負擔

一個編碼不佳、功能臃腫的 WordPress 主題會載入大量未使用的指令碼、樣式和字型,嚴重拖慢網站。同樣,安裝過多外掛,尤其是那些頻繁進行資料庫查詢或在每個頁面都載入資源的外掛,會顯著增加伺服器響應時間。選擇輕量級、程式碼規範的主題和外掛是最佳化第一步。

UltaHost WordPress 主機
30天退款保證,無限頻寬與資料庫,免費的 DDoS 防護,購買3年優惠50%

未經最佳化的靜態資源

未經壓縮和合並的大型圖片是導致頁面體積過大的首要原因。此外,JavaScript 和 CSS 檔案如果沒有被壓縮、合併或非同步載入,會阻塞頁面渲染,導致使用者看到白屏的時間變長。

核心最佳化策略與實施

針對上述瓶頸,我們可以從以下幾個核心方面入手進行系統最佳化。

实施高效的缓存机制

快取是提升 WordPress 速度最有效的手段之一。它透過儲存頁面、資料庫查詢結果的靜態副本,減少伺服器處理負擔。你可以使用外掛如 W3 Total Cache 或者 WP Rocket 來輕鬆配置頁面快取、物件快取和瀏覽器快取。

例如,在 wp-config.php 檔案中啟用物件快取(如 Redis)可以透過新增以下程式碼實現:

推荐阅读 《WordPress优化终极指南:从页面速度到SEO,全面提升性能的策略》

define('WP_REDIS_HOST', '127.0.0.1');
define('WP_REDIS_PORT', 6379);
define('WP_CACHE_KEY_SALT', 'your_unique_prefix_');

最佳化資料庫與減少查詢

隨著時間推移,WordPress 資料庫會積累大量修訂版本、草稿、垃圾評論等冗餘資料,導致查詢變慢。定期清理最佳化資料庫至關重要。可以使用 WP-Optimize 外掛或手動執行 SQL 命令來清理。

此外,審查主題模板檔案,避免在迴圈中使用 query_posts,而應使用更高效的 WP_Query 並確保使用了正確的引數。例如,在側邊欄顯示最新文章時,應指定返回的文章數量:

$recent_posts = new WP_Query(array(
    'posts_per_page' => 5,
    'no_found_rows'  => true, // 禁用分页计数以提升速度
));

壓縮與延遲載入媒體檔案

確保所有上傳的圖片都經過壓縮。可以使用外掛如 ShortPixelImagify 或線上工具在上傳前壓縮。同時,為圖片實現“懶載入”(Lazy Load)技術,讓圖片僅在進入使用者視口時載入,能極大提升首屏速度。

hostng.com 共享主机
高效能,配备 AMD EPYC CPU、NVMe SSD 存储和 LiteSpeed,全天候 24 小时专业内部支持,先进的安全措施包括 SSL、暴力破解、恶意软件和 DDoS 防护,节省高达 731 TB/月的带宽成本。

現代 WordPress 版本已內建了圖片懶載入功能,你也可以透過 Lazy Load by WP Rocket 等外掛獲得更全面的控制。對於影片,建議使用嵌入連結(如 YouTube)而非直接上傳,以節省伺服器頻寬。

高階技術與程式碼級最佳化

當基礎最佳化完成後,可以透過一些高階技術進一步壓榨效能。

最小化併合並CSS與JavaScript檔案

透過外掛(如 Autoptimize)或構建工具,將多個 CSS 和 JS 檔案合併為少數幾個,並移除其中的空白字元、註釋,進行壓縮。這能減少 HTTP 請求次數和檔案體積。注意操作後務必進行測試,避免因合併順序問題導致功能錯誤。

推荐阅读 全面掌握WordPress优化技巧,提升网站速度和SEO排名。

實施關鍵CSS與非同步載入

“關鍵CSS”是指用於渲染首屏內容所必需的最小樣式集合。你可以使用工具提取這些樣式並內嵌在 HTML 的 <head> 中,其餘非關鍵樣式則非同步載入。對於 JavaScript,使用 async 或者 defer 屬性可以防止其阻塞頁面渲染。

<!-- 异步加载不影响页面结构的脚本 -->
<script src="script.js" async></script>
<!-- 延迟加载,在文档解析完成后执行 -->
<script src="script.js" defer></script>

利用CDN加速全球訪問

內容分發網路(CDN)將你的靜態資源(圖片、CSS、JS、字型)快取到全球各地的伺服器上。當用戶訪問時,會從距離最近的伺服器獲取這些資源,大幅降低延遲。Cloudflare、StackPath 都是流行的選擇。許多優質 WordPress 主機也提供了整合 CDN 服務。

InterServer 共享主机
虚拟主机的月费为1TB+5TB,价格为2.50美元。首月优惠价为1TB+5TB,价格为0.1美元。优惠码为"tryinterserver"。平台提供461个云应用脚本,一键安装便捷。

監控與持續維護

最佳化不是一勞永逸的,需要持續監控和維護以保持最佳狀態。

使用效能測試工具

定期使用工具如 Google PageSpeed Insights、GTmetrix 或 WebPageTest 測試你的網站。它們不僅能給出評分,還會提供具體的、可操作的改進建議。關注“最大內容繪製”、“首次輸入延遲”等核心 Web 指標。

定期更新和进行安全审计

始終保持 WordPress 核心、主題和外掛更新到最新版本。更新通常包含效能改進和安全補丁。同時,定期審查已安裝的外掛,停用並刪除那些不再使用的。一個不活躍的外掛也可能成為安全漏洞和效能拖累。

分析真實使用者監控資料

使用像 Google Analytics 4 或專門的真實使用者監控工具,瞭解真實使用者在訪問你網站時的效能表現。這能幫助你發現那些在實驗室測試中無法復現的、特定地域或網路條件下的效能問題。

总结

WordPress 網站最佳化是一個涉及伺服器環境、程式碼質量、資源管理和持續監控的系統性工程。從選擇優質的託管服務開始,實施強大的快取策略,最佳化資料庫和媒體檔案,再到進行程式碼級的CSS/JS最佳化和啟用CDN,每一步都能為網站速度帶來顯著提升。記住,最佳化的最終目標是提升使用者體驗和業務轉化,因此,在追求技術指標的同時,也應關注真實使用者的訪問感受。定期測試、持續迭代,你的 WordPress 網站必將變得快速而高效。

常见问题解答(FAQ)

啟用快取外掛後,網站更新內容不顯示怎麼辦?

這是快取機制的常見現象。所有優秀的快取外掛都提供了“清除快取”的功能。當你釋出新文章、修改頁面或更新設定後,應手動前往快取外掛設定頁面清除所有快取。某些外掛也支援設定自動清除快取規則,例如在釋出文章時自動清除首頁和分類頁快取。

我應該選擇哪款快取外掛?

WP Rocket 是一款優秀的付費外掛,以其開箱即用、配置簡單且效果顯著而聞名,適合大多數使用者。對於喜歡深度自定義的技術使用者,W3 Total Cache 提供了極其詳盡的配置選項。而 LiteSpeed Cache 則在與 LiteSpeed 伺服器搭配時能發揮出最佳效能,並且是免費的。

最佳化後網站速度測試分數依然不高,可能是什麼原因?

測試分數低可能由多種原因導致。首先,檢查是否使用了來自第三方伺服器的資源(如字型、指令碼),這些外部資源的載入速度會影響你的分數。其次,伺服器響應時間可能過慢,這屬於主機效能問題。最後,確保你已正確實施所有最佳化步驟,例如圖片是否真的被壓縮,CDN是否成功生效。有時,更換一個更輕量級的主題可能是根本解決方案。

資料庫最佳化有風險嗎?如何安全操作?

直接操作資料庫存在風險,錯誤的刪除可能導致網站功能異常。在進行任何手動最佳化前,務必透過外掛或主機控制面板備份完整資料庫。使用 WP-Optimize 這類信譽良好的外掛進行清理是相對安全的方式,因為它執行的是經過驗證的安全查詢。對於修訂版和草稿的清理,通常是非常安全的。

為什麼需要使用CDN,它如何工作?

CDN 透過將你網站的靜態檔案副本儲存在全球多個地點的伺服器上,使使用者可以從地理位置上最近的伺服器獲取資料,從而減少網路延遲和頻寬消耗。它不僅能加速網站載入,還能在一定程度上幫助抵禦流量攻擊。對於擁有全球訪客或媒體資源豐富的網站,CDN 帶來的速度提升尤為明顯。